Форум программистов, компьютерный форум, киберфорум
Scala
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
 
0 / 0 / 0
Регистрация: 18.12.2014
Сообщений: 4
1

Обработка исключительных ситуаций по Б.Мейеру

19.12.2014, 21:25. Показов 2630. Ответов 0
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
Здравствуйте! Можете мне помочь в одном деле? Стояла вот такая задача:

Разработать программу, генерирующую исключительную ситуацию, и обрабатывающую вызванное исключение на языке программирования scala. Доработать написанную программу, применив схему обработки исключительных ситуаций Б. Мейера.

Первую часть задания я выполнил. Проблема заключается в том, что я не понимаю как можно, и без того простой код, записать по схеме Б.Мейера. Не могли бы Вы помочь мне разобраться в этой ситуации?

Код:
Java
1
2
3
4
5
6
7
def getURLContent (url: String): Try [Iterator[String]]=
    for {
       url <- parseURL(url)
       connection <- Try(url.openConnection())
       is <- Try(connection.getInputStream)
       source = Source.fromInputStream(is)
    } yield source.getLines()
for-генерация исключений с обработкой. Ошибка может произойти в трёх местах, но оператор try обработает их.
0
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
19.12.2014, 21:25
Ответы с готовыми решениями:

Обработка исключительных ситуаций
Здравствуйте! В данном коде надо выполнить обработку исключительных ситуаций с использованием...

Обработка исключительных ситуаций
Добрый день. Помоги разобраться с обработкой исключительных ситуаций. Вот я написал класс...

Обработка исключительных ситуаций
Доброго времени суток уважаемы программисты и начинающие программисты :) Скажите, почему появляется...

Обработка исключительных ситуаций
Здравствуйте, друзья. Подскажите, пожалуйста, как можно при помощи try-throw-catch &quot;защититься&quot; от...

0
19.12.2014, 21:25
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
19.12.2014, 21:25
Помогаю со студенческими работами здесь

Обработка исключительных ситуаций
Мне нужно было создать шаблонный класс и написать обработку исключающих ситуаций. Вот, что я сделал...

Обработка исключительных ситуаций
Когда вместо числа вводишь строку паскаль выдаёт Ошибку 106: Invalid Numeric Format и прога...

Обработка исключительных ситуаций
Почему не происходит вывод массива? import java.util.Scanner; public class Array { public...

Обработка исключительных ситуаций
catch(Exception &amp;ex){ Application-&gt;MessageBoxA(ex.Message.c_str(),&quot;Ошибка1&quot;); ...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
1
Ответ Создать тему
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ru